查询性能低下:Oracle优化问题与实践
在数据库管理中,尤其是大型的数据库系统如Oracle,查询性能低下常常是优化问题的关键。以下是一些常见的Oracle优化问题以及相应的实践方法:
表设计不合理:比如数据冗余、列选择不当时等问题。优化方式包括规范化设计,减少冗余。
索引使用不当:如果某些查询对某些列的排序并不关心,但列仍然被创建了索引,这会降低性能。应根据查询条件动态调整索引。
SQL语句优化:这涉及到语法简洁性、避免全表扫描等。可以通过编写更高效的存储过程或者函数来实现。
硬件资源限制:如内存不足、CPU核心数过少等。优化方式包括增加硬件资源,合理分配和使用资源。
总之,Oracle查询性能低下问题的解决需要从数据库设计、索引管理、SQL语句优化以及硬件资源等多个角度进行综合考虑和实践。
还没有评论,来说两句吧...